[0066] In order to make the object, technical solution and advantages of the present invention clearer, the present invention will be described in further detail below in conjunction with specific embodiments and with reference to the accompanying drawings.
[0067] Refer to attached figure 1 , is a schematic flowchart of the three-dimensional streamline visualization method of the groundwater flow field provided by the present invention. As an embodiment of the present invention, the three-dimensional streamline visualization method of the groundwater flow field includes the following steps:
[0068] Step 101: using the triangular prism continuous Galerkin finite element method to solve the groundwater flow numerical model, forming the original triangular prism unit grid and obtaining groundwater head field data.
